Description

Prime Point Grey location, within walking distance of Lord Byng Secondary. Situated on a generous 42' × 122' lot with a sunny south-facing front yard and mature fruit trees. Enjoy beautiful mountain views, with potential ocean views from a future two-storey home. The spacious 2-bedroom lower-level suite with skylight ideal for extended family or as a mortgage helper. This 5-bedroom, 2-bathroom home offers excellent potential to renovate and enjoy or build your dream home. Top catchment schools: Queen Elizabeth Elementary and Lord Byng Secondary, with top private schools West Point Grey Academy, St. George´s, OLPH, etc. nearby. Easy access to restaurants, cafés, shops, transit and amenities. A rare opportunity in one of Vancouver´s most desirable neighborhoods! (id:63159)

How this is calculated

Amenities: points awarded per category (restaurants, cafes, grocery, parks, shopping, gyms, pharmacies, banks/ATMs, healthcare) based on distance to the nearest one — 3 points under 200m, 2 points under 500m, 1 point under 800m — summed across all 9 categories and scaled to 0–100.

Transit: based on the number of transit stops within 800m and their mode (SkyTrain weighted highest, then streetcar/ferry, then bus). This reflects stop type and count only — our data doesn't include how often a route actually runs, so frequency is never factored in.

Both scores depend on how much of the surrounding area has been synced from OpenStreetMap and TransLink's GTFS feed. A lower score can mean fewer amenities nearby, or simply that this area hasn't been fully synced yet — not a confident measurement of the location itself.

Minimum down payment: 5% on the first $500,000, 10% on the portion up to $1.5M, 20% at/above $1.5M. Stress test: OSFI's minimum qualifying rate, the greater of contract rate + 2% or 5.25% — this is what lenders require you to qualify at, not what you'll actually pay. Closing costs are a typical-range estimate, not a quote — actual legal fees vary. Verify all figures with a mortgage broker and lawyer before relying on them.
